Accountant SEO: What We Focus On
Google Business Profile for Professional Services
Accounting profile optimization differs from restaurants. Categories (Accountant vs. Tax Preparation Service vs. Certified Public Accountant) have meaningful impact on which searches you appear in. Service listings, credential displays, and appointment booking links increase conversion from a map results click to a consultation call. Most CPA profiles use the wrong primary category and miss their best search traffic.

Seasonal Keyword Coverage
'Tax preparer near me' peaks in February. 'Small business accountant' searches are evergreen. 'Year-end bookkeeping' spikes in October. We build a content calendar that targets each seasonal query window with corresponding landing pages, not one generic homepage trying to rank for everything. The right content published at the right time in the tax calendar captures clients when they're ready to switch.

Professional Directory Citations
CPADirectory.com, AICPA member directory, state CPA society listings, Thumbtack, and local business directories. Consistent name, address, and phone number across professional citations is a map ranking prerequisite. Most CPA firms have 3-5 inconsistent citations: a slightly wrong address, an old suite number, an outdated phone. We audit and correct across 40+ sources to eliminate citation suppression.

Google Trust Signals
Google applies extra scrutiny to financial content. CPA license numbers, state board membership, professional association badges, and structured data that communicates credentials to Google's quality systems directly affect your ability to rank for high-value search queries. Most CPA websites lack all four.
